Centropogon propagation is typically achieved through seeds or stem cuttings, which should be started during the early spring season for optimal growth.

Seeds require a well-draining, moist potting mix and should be placed in a warm environment with temperatures maintained between 20 and 22 degrees Celsius.
For cuttings, select healthy semi-hardwood shoots and place them in a rooting medium such as perlite or peat to ensure rapid root development.
Young plants should be protected from direct sunlight and kept in a humid environment until they are fully established in their individual pots.
Gradual acclimatization to outdoor conditions is necessary if the plants are intended for terrace or garden display during the warm summer months.
Belonging to the Campanulaceae family, Centropogon is a fascinating genus native to the tropical cloud forests of Central and South America.
This plant thrives in high-humidity environments and requires bright, filtered light to maintain its lush foliage and vibrant flowering cycle.
Soil composition must be rich in organic matter and slightly acidic to mimic the natural forest floor conditions where these plants originate.
Consistent moisture is key, yet the substrate must have excellent drainage to prevent root suffocation and subsequent decay of the plant.
Temperature control is vital, as the species generally dislikes extreme heat and is intolerant of any frost, requiring indoor shelter in colder climates.
The primary pests affecting Centropogon include spider mites and whiteflies, which frequently attack the plant when indoor air becomes too dry.
Fungal issues, particularly root rot, are common symptoms of improper drainage or overwatering, often exacerbated by stagnant air conditions.
Powdery mildew may also manifest on the leaves if the plants are crowded together without sufficient air circulation between the stems.
Integrated pest management, including regular inspection and the use of neem oil or insecticidal soaps, is highly recommended for control.
Maintaining a clean growing environment and removing any dead or decaying tissue is essential to minimize the risk of pathogen outbreaks.
